Trainee / Graduate Electrical Design Engineer / Electrical Planner | Trainee / Absolvent als Elektrokonstrukteur / Elektroplaner (m/w/d)
Oehmichen & Bürgers Industrieplanung GmbH
Job Summary
This Trainee/Graduate position is ideal for aspiring professionals eager to launch their careers in hardware planning for energy and control technology systems. The role involves an intensive eight-week training program in Düsseldorf, focusing on the EPLAN planning software and electrical design fundamentals, tailored to individual experience levels. Upon completion, you will transition into an Electrical Planner role, working on projects conveniently located near your residence. Candidates should possess a degree in Electrical Engineering or Mechatronics, or a Bachelor Professional (Technician qualification), coupled with a keen interest in industrial energy and control systems. This opportunity offers a stable, family-oriented work environment with flexible hours, home office options, and comprehensive benefits, including a secure salary and continuous professional development.
